Job Purpose:
The IT System Administrator analyzes, designs, documents, configures, and manages the infrastructure and systems utilized by Ultramain. Ensuring the availability, scalability, monitoring, and security of Ultramain’s cloud-based and on-premises infrastructure and systems. Responsible for the end-to-end management, maintenance, and administration of the IT ecosystem including servers, storage, networking, security, backup and recovery, and applications. Collaborate closely with development, operations, and other teams to align IT infrastructure, systems, and processes with business requirements and goals.
Responsibilities:
- Monitor and audit cloud and on-premises infrastructures to ensure operational capacity and stability.
- Troubleshoot and resolve issues in cloud and on-premises environments.
- Provide and maintain an infrastructure environment to support application development and departmental activities.
- Implement and maintain computer hardware and software applications within the IT infrastructure, including, but not limited to, servers, workstations, storage, network, IT security, server virtualization, and accessories.
- Evaluate and recommend system design and configuration to achieve optimized performance.
- Evaluate infrastructure and recommend changes for improvement.
- Develop detailed design and documentation of infrastructure and operational processes.
- Perform capacity planning and recommend infrastructure changes to meet current and future needs.
- Contribute to the development and administration of business continuity and disaster recovery plans.
- Perform system monitoring to proactively avoid issues.
- Perform system testing to ensure that infrastructure and processes are working as expected.
- Resolve infrastructure issues when they occur to ensure the business can continue working.
- Evaluate and analyze technical issues to arrive at resolutions to problems and solutions to challenges.
- Execute technology projects and changes successfully with minimum downtime and user disruption.
- Utilize infrastructure-related scripts to automate and streamline operational activities.
- Checking and troubleshooting computer hardware to ensure functionality.
- Install and troubleshoot network-related equipment such as patch panels, switches, and cabling.
- Administer telephone communications for Ultramain staff including cell, internal, and other phone systems.
- Accurately document policies, procedures, and system configurations.
- Document and maintain software and hardware inventories.
- Audit and meter software licenses.
- Configure and maintain backups of server software, file shares, and databases.
- Perform a recovery of missing or lost data or files as needed.
- Install and maintain database platforms. Create and administer databases used within the organization.
- Maintain network security through Active Directory management, maintenance of network firewalls, and ensuring software and antivirus is properly installed and updated on servers and workstations.
- Provide technical support to Ultramain employees.
- Organize and schedule upgrades and maintenance without deterring others from completing their work.
- Maintain records/logs of repairs and fixes and maintenance schedule.
- Provides accurate and detailed reports of errors found while using Ultramain software.
- Maintains software product archives, archive documentation, and logs.
- Adhere to the organization’s Information Security Management System (ISMS), complying with the ISO 27001 and other standards. Responsible for maintaining the confidentiality, integrity, and availability of information assets and collaborating with cross-functional teams to support ongoing risk management, incident response, and continuous improvement of IT systems.
Requirements:
- At least 3-5 years of experience in Information Technology.
- Bachelor's degree or higher college degree or equivalent experience in a related field.
- Has experience managing technical projects.
- Technical understanding of IT hardware and software systems.
- Knowledge of virtual environments including VMs, containers, and public cloud environments.
- Knowledge of security frameworks such as ISO 27001, NIST Cybersecurity Framework and GDPR (data protection).
- Must be available for after-hours and weekend emergency situations or for IT system maintenance/updates.
